Common Nut Sizes for Toyota Sienna


The Toyota Sienna, like many vehicles, utilizes a variety of nut sizes throughout its construction. Here are some of the most common sizes you may encounter:



  • Wheel Lug Nuts: Typically, the wheel lug nuts on a Toyota Sienna are 12mm x 1.5.

  • Engine Components: Various engine components may use nuts sized at 10mm, 12mm, or 14mm, depending on the specific part.

  • Suspension Parts: Suspension components often require 14mm or 17mm nuts for secure attachment.

  • Body Panels: For body panels, you might find 8mm or 10mm nuts used in various locations.

What bolt pattern is a Sienna?


5x114.3
What bolt pattern does the Toyota Sienna have? The Toyota Sienna comes with a 5x114. 3 bolt pattern, more often referred to as a 5x4. 5 bolt pattern.



Is 13/16 the same as 21mm?


13/16 and 21 mm are very close and either will work. Like less than half a mm discrepancy. That's why it lists both. Technically the 13/16 is the smaller and more correct size.

What size are the lug nuts on a 2013 Toyota Sienna?


The 2013 Toyota Sienna uses lug nuts that have thread measuring M12 X1. 50. From the factory, the lug nuts should be 13/16 inches or 21mm, though aftermarket lugs occasionally require a different size tire iron.



Is 19mm the same as 3/4?


Yes. 3/4″ is . 750″ and 19mm is 0.74803 Inches. Only 2 thousands of an inch difference.

How do I know what size thread I have?


You simply count the number of thread peaks along a one-inch length. You'll also measure the major diameter of the screw, as shown above. These two measurements will combine to give you the screw size you need. For instance, if your major diameter is ¼″ and you have 20 threads per inch, then your screw size is ¼″ x 20.
